摘要
a method of integrated fault estimation(FE) and fault-tolerant control(FTC) for discrete nonlinear systems with actuator faults is proposed. Firstly, the observer is designed to get the error equation and the fault-tolerant controller is designed to obtain closed-loop control system. Then consider the coupling of them, an augmented system of system error and state are established. Secondly, the augmentation system can be design by H-infinity control to realize integrated FE/FTC. Finally, the proposed method isapplied to by the flight control system.
